Product Information

4-Chloropyrrolo[2,3-d]pyrimidine is a versatile heterocyclic compound that has garnered attention in pharmaceutical research and development. This compound is recognized for its potential as a building block in the synthesis of various bioactive molecules, particularly in the field of medicinal chemistry. Its unique structure allows for the exploration of novel therapeutic agents, especially in the treatment of cancer and neurological disorders. Researchers have utilized 4-Chloropyrrolo[2,3-d]pyrimidine in the development of kinase inhibitors and other targeted therapies, showcasing its relevance in contemporary drug discovery.

Additionally, this compound's properties make it an attractive candidate for further exploration in agrochemical applications, where it may serve as a precursor for the synthesis of innovative pesticides or herbicides. The ability to modify its structure opens avenues for creating compounds with enhanced efficacy and reduced environmental impact. Synonyms
4-Chloro-1H-pyrrolo[2,3-d]pyrimidine, 6-Chloro-7-deazapurine
CAS Number
3680-69-1
Purity
≥ 98% (Assay)
Molecular Formula
C6H4ClN3
Molecular Weight
153.57
MDL Number
MFCD01686865
PubChem ID
5356682
Melting Point
184 - 190 ?C (Lit.)
Appearance
White or yellowish to off-white crystalline powder
Conditions
Store at 0 - 8 °C

Applications

4-Chloropyrrolo[2,3-d]pyrimidine is widely utilized in research focused on:

  • Pharmaceutical Development: This compound serves as a key intermediate in the synthesis of various pharmaceuticals, particularly in the development of drugs targeting cancer and neurological disorders.
  • Biochemical Research: It is used in studies exploring enzyme inhibition and receptor interactions, aiding researchers in understanding complex biological pathways.
  • Agricultural Chemistry: The compound finds applications in the formulation of agrochemicals, contributing to the development of effective pesticides and herbicides that enhance crop protection.
  • Material Science: It is employed in the synthesis of novel materials, including polymers and coatings, which exhibit improved properties for various industrial applications.
  • Diagnostic Tools: Researchers utilize this chemical in the development of diagnostic agents, particularly in imaging techniques that require specific targeting of biological markers.
